Output e3fbbc7d58be1f3ef58e0dca4dafe501b38854eab8b7afcb6956f645e0795c86:58

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 2ef507809443b1f8f6ed8d537bbb4dde926202a5
address
bc1q9m6s0qy5gwcl3ahd34fhhw6dm6fxyq49v77s8y
transaction
e3fbbc7d58be1f3ef58e0dca4dafe501b38854eab8b7afcb6956f645e0795c86